This station is designed to cater to travelers' diverse needs. Ticket buying is a breeze with a ticket office available Monday to Saturday from 06:10 to 19:30, slightly varying on Sundays. Self-service ticket machines streamline your journey, and the station supports smartcard issuance and validation. Accessibility is paramount here, with step-free access in parts of the station, an induction loop, and ramps available for train access. While the station doesn't include a waiting room, there are seating areas and accessible toilets available.
While there's no luggage storage or waiting lounge, a coffee shop ensures you're fueled for your journey, alongside a newspaper shop for a light read. Keep in mind that while CCTV is in operation for safety, public wifi and an ATM aren't available at this station. Cyclists will find sheltered spaces by the ticket office, encouraged to leave bikes here at their own risk due to the absence of CCTV coverage in this area.
Interconnectivity with other forms of transport is seamless, thanks to multiple bus connections. For instance, travelers heading towards Lewisham can catch their bus at the Kidbrooke Park Road Bus Stop L, pinpointed by the innovative what3words address: "media.spoke.spice". Meanwhile, those traveling towards Dartford should look out for Bus Stop M, known as "tunnel.hulk.jumpy". Access more information on travel connections and routes in a convenient printable format.

Streatham Hill station offers a wide array of facilities aimed at ensuring a smooth travel experience for all passengers. The ticket office is open throughout the week, making it easier for travelers to purchase and collect tickets on the go. Operating hours vary slightly, with the office open from 6:10 AM on weekdays, starting a little later on Saturday at 6:40 AM, and Sunday at 8:10 AM. For convenience, the station is equipped with both standard and accessible ticket machines suitable for all travelers, including those using Disabled Persons Railcards.
In addition to ticketing facilities, there’s robust support available to assist passengers with special requirements. Streatham Hill is a Category A station, reassuring passengers of step-free access to all platforms and an accessible design throughout. If you need additional help, station staff provide assistance from the first to the last train, and there’re customer help points strategically located within the station.
Though there are no waiting room facilities, passengers can find a seating area to rest before their journey. Refreshments and shopping options are available, adding convenience to your travel. It's also important to note the absence of accessible toilets and baby changing facilities, which might be a consideration for particular travelers.
Making onward travel from Streatham Hill is a breeze with various transport links at your disposal. Local bus services are readily available, and further information can be accessed through the 'Onward Travel Information Map' displayed in the station. Although there are no accessible taxis directly at the station, the local transport network compensates for this with well-connected bus services making it easy to reach your next destination.
